Illinois SB 3338 (97th) — ELEC CD-POLLING PLACE

Amends the Election Code. Specifies that the area on polling place property beyond the campaign free zone that qualifies as a public forum includes immediately adjacent sidewalks and parkways.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2012-02-07 Filed with Secretary by Sen. Don Harmon filing
  • 2012-02-07 First Reading reading-1
  • 2012-02-07 Referred to Assignments referral-committee
  • 2012-02-17 Assigned to Executive referral-committee
  • 2012-02-24 To Executive Subcommittee on Election Law
  • 2012-03-09 Rule 2-10 Committee Deadline Established As March 30, 2012
  • 2012-03-22 Reported Back To Executive; 003-000-000
  • 2012-03-26 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Filed with Secretary by Sen. Don Harmon amendment-introduction
  • 2012-03-26 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Referred to Assignments referral-committee
  • 2012-03-26 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Assignments Refers to Executive
  • 2012-03-27 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Adopted amendment-passage
  • 2012-03-27 Do Pass as Amended Executive; 010-000-000 committee-passage
  • 2012-03-27 Placed on Calendar Order of 2nd Reading March 28, 2012
  • 2012-03-28 Second Reading reading-2
  • 2012-03-28 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ading March 29, 2012
  • 2012-03-29 Third Reading - Passed; 054-001-000 reading-3, passage
  • 2012-03-29 Arrived in House introduction
  • 2012-04-11 Chief House Sponsor Rep. Barbara Flynn Currie
  • 2012-04-11 Placed on Calendar Order of First Reading reading-1
  • 2012-04-17 First Reading reading-1
  • 2012-04-17 Referred to Rules Committee referral-committee
  • 2012-04-19 Assigned to Elections & Campaign Reform Committee referral-committee
  • 2012-04-27 Added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Rep. Michael J. Zalewski
  • 2012-05-04 Committee Deadline Extended-Rule 9(b) May 18, 2012
  • 2012-05-10 Do Pass / Short Debate Elections & Campaign Reform Committee; 006-000-000 committee-passage
  • 2012-05-10 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ate
  • 2012-05-22 Second Reading - Short Debate reading-2
  • 2012-05-22 Held on Calendar Order of Second Reading - Short Debate reading-2
  • 2012-05-25 Final Action Deadline Extended-9(b) May 31, 2012
  • 2012-05-31 Rule 19(a) / Re-referred to Rules Committee referral-committee
  • 2012-11-09 Approved for Consideration Rules Committee; 003-002-000
  • 2012-11-09 Final Action Deadline Extended-9(b) January 8, 2013
  • 2012-11-14 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ate
  • 2012-11-26 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Filed with Clerk by Rep. Barbara Flynn Currie amendment-introduction
  • 2012-11-26 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Referred to Rules Committee referral-committee
  • 2012-11-26 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Rules Refers to Elections & Campaign Reform Committee
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Rep. Sandra M. Pihos
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Rep. Renée Kosel
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Rep. Chapin Rose
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Timothy L. Schmitz
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Michael Unes
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Pam Roth
  • 2012-11-27 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Recommends Be Adopted Elections & Campaign Reform Committee; 005-000-000 committee-passage-favorable
  • 2012-11-27 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Robert W. Pritchard
  • 2012-11-28 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Adopted by Voice Vote amendment-passage
  • 2012-11-28 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ading - Short Debate
  • 2012-11-28 3/5 Vote Required
  • 2012-11-28 Third Reading - Short Debate - Passed 114-000-000 reading-3, passage
  • 2012-11-28 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Thaddeus Jones
  • 2012-11-28 Secretary's Desk - Concurrence House Amendment(s) 1
  • 2012-11-28 Placed on Calendar Order of Concurrence House Amendment(s) 1 - November 29, 2012
  • 2012-11-28 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Motion to Concur Filed with Secretary Sen. Don Harmon filing
  • 2012-11-28 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Motion to Concur Referred to Assignments referral-committee
  • 2012-11-28 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Motion to Concur Assignments Referred to Executive referral-committee
  • 2012-11-29 Added as Co-Sponsor Sen. Pamela J. Althoff
  • 2012-11-29 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Motion To Concur Recommended Do Adopt Executive; 013-000-000
  • 2012-11-29 Added as Chief Co-Sponsor Sen. Pat McGuire
  • 2012-11-29 3/5 Vote Required
  • 2012-11-29 House Floor Amendment No. 1 Senate Concurs 053-000-000
  • 2012-11-29 Passed Both Houses
  • 2012-11-29 Sent to the Governor executive-receipt
  • 2012-12-03 Governor Approved executive-signature
  • 2012-12-03 Effective Date December 3, 2012
  • 2012-12-03 Public Act . . . . . . . . . 97-1134 became-law
